Music has long been a powerful force for social change, with many artists using their platform to speak out against injustice and promote positive values. From Bob Marley's anti-apartheid anthems to Kendrick Lamar's critiques of systemic racism, music has been a powerful tool for social commentary and activism. Today, the entertainment industry is more diverse and complex than ever before. The rise of streaming services has led to a shift away from traditional TV and movie-going, with many consumers opting for on-demand content instead.
As we look to the future, it's clear that entertainment content and popular media will continue to evolve and shape our culture and society. The rise of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ies is likely to revolutionize the way we experience entertainment, with immersive and interactive experiences becoming more mainstream.
